Job Description
We are looking for Sustainability Analysts for Inter IKEA.
In Inter IKEA, we are ready to put in the next gear of moving IKEA and making us better together.
We are now looking for a Sustainability Analysts to help us define, develop, and maintain strategic commitments and goals that are connected to sustainability topics such as biodiversity, water, climate change, fair and equal, circular economy, waste, etc with a high impact on the IKEA business. Please note that this is a temporary role for 11 months.
The role includes developing and ensuring the impact of strategic topics is measured and reported across the value chain and to support the identification of opportunities and gaps to reach our goals. You will be responsible for ensuring a holistic view of strategic topics and monitoring external global agreements, commitments, standards, and new legislations to secure the business and its license to operate.
To be successful in this role we believe that you are able to:
- Responsible to measure, assess and analyse IKEAs environmental, social, and economic impact to identify opportunities to reduce the negative and enhance positive impacts.
- Lead the development of content and data to secure sustainability reporting obligations are fulfilled such as CSRD, due diligence reporting etc.
- Assess, implement, and influence the development of measurement methodologies to support strategic sustainability topics across IKEA's value chain.
- Work closely with the Data and Technology team to integrate business requirements into our data products to meet internal and external reporting needs.
- Safeguard the relevance of methodologies and performance frameworks by monitoring new standards, legislation, and best practices.
- Ensure compliance and external assurance by documenting and controlling sustainability impact data.
- Maintain and improve data products and solutions for sustainability impact data, and conduct strategic analysis on total IKEA value chain level.
- Advise and build competence in sustainability and related functions in the business, and support development of solutions for performance follow-up and scenario analysis.
- Lead and influence people through indirect leadership.
Qualifications
To be successful in the role,
- We believe you have excellent analytical skills in data and complex systems.
- You are a creative problem solver who sees data as both a solution and a tool.
- You have strong knowledge and experience in sustainability topics, data analysis and modelling and performance follow-up and goal-setting within a complex company set-up.
- You also have strong communication skills and knowledge of strategic sustainability topics and proven capability of working well in a team and with many different stakeholders.
- Experience in external reporting standards e.g. CSRD, SBTN, TNFD and the Greenhouse Gas Protocol is seen as an advantage.
